Output e75a7912ead693784fc3f19572a39de0230094d9ba67f2d5c7b3263401fd27e7:2

value
43045162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dbf9bf2bf9f0e5b51e35cf5f5d3a46c4dc797d1 OP_EQUAL
address
32wiFGydehsVaP3R1aqcofjXoN3J1MFa14
transaction
e75a7912ead693784fc3f19572a39de0230094d9ba67f2d5c7b3263401fd27e7
confirmations
174683
spent
true